The Cytiva Top of Utah Marathon, celebrating its 27th year in 2025, is a premier running event set in the scenic Cache Valley of Logan, Utah. Held on Saturday, September 20, 2025, it offers a diverse range of distances to accommodate all levels of runners: a full Marathon (26.2 miles), a 20K (approximately 12.4 miles), a challenging 10K Trail Race, and a family-friendly 5K. Known for its flat and fast course, the marathon is a certified Boston Marathon qualifier and also serves as the USA Track & Field Utah Marathon Championship Race, drawing competitive runners with significant prize money. Participants will enjoy a course that winds along the Logan River Trail, through country roads and wetlands, all set against the stunning backdrop of the Cache National Forest and Wellsville Mountain Range, culminating in a festive downtown Logan finish.
